Supplementary Data: Kapitza thermal resistance across individual grain boundaries in graphene
<p>The data here are the numerical bi-crystalline graphene samples used in Ref. [1].</p> <p>There are 13 folders named "1", "2", ..., "13". Each folder contains a file named "xyz.in". They are in the format of the "xyz.in" file used in the GPUMD package [2]. From folder "1" to "13", the tilt angle increases monotonically. See Table 1 of Ref. [1] for the values of the tilt angles.</p> <p>[1] Khatereh Azizi, Petri Hirvonen, Zheyong Fan, Ari Harju, Ken R Elder, Tapio Ala-Nissila, and S Mehdi Vaez Allaei,<br> Kapitza thermal resistance across individual grain boundaries in graphene,<br> Carbon 125, 384 (2017).<br> https://doi.org/10.1016/j.carbon.2017.09.059<br> https://arxiv.org/abs/1709.09529</p> <p>[2] Zheyong Fan, GPUMD,<br> https://github.com/brucefan1983/GPUMD<br> http://doi.org/10.5281/zenodo.995667</p> <p> </p>
